33
1 © Copyright 2012 EMC Corporation. All rights reserved. EMC INFRASTRUCTURE FOR MICROSOFT APPLICATIONS IN THE PRIVATE CLOUD EMC Symmetrix VMAX 10K, EMC VNX5700, EMC RecoverPoint/Cluster Enabler, Microsoft Exchange, SharePoint, SQL Server, Microsoft Hyper-V EMC Solutions Group Technical Presentation

EMC Infrastructure for Microsoft Applications in the Private Cloud

  • Upload
    frieda

  • View
    71

  • Download
    0

Embed Size (px)

DESCRIPTION

EMC Infrastructure for Microsoft Applications in the Private Cloud. EMC Symmetrix VMAX 10K, EMC VNX5700, EMC RecoverPoint/Cluster Enabler, Microsoft Exchange, SharePoint, SQL Server, Microsoft Hyper-V. Technical Presentation. EMC Solutions Group. Agenda. Solution Overview - PowerPoint PPT Presentation

Citation preview

Page 1: EMC Infrastructure for Microsoft Applications in the Private Cloud

1© Copyright 2012 EMC Corporation. All rights reserved.

EMC INFRASTRUCTURE FOR MICROSOFT APPLICATIONS IN THE PRIVATE CLOUDEMC Symmetrix VMAX 10K, EMC VNX5700, EMC RecoverPoint/Cluster Enabler, Microsoft Exchange, SharePoint, SQL Server, Microsoft Hyper-V

EMC Solutions Group

Technical Presentation

Page 2: EMC Infrastructure for Microsoft Applications in the Private Cloud

2© Copyright 2012 EMC Corporation. All rights reserved.

Agenda Solution Overview Application Design and Test Results System Management DR Design and Test Results Summary

Page 3: EMC Infrastructure for Microsoft Applications in the Private Cloud

3© Copyright 2012 EMC Corporation. All rights reserved.

Solution Overview

Page 4: EMC Infrastructure for Microsoft Applications in the Private Cloud

4© Copyright 2012 EMC Corporation. All rights reserved.

Solution Objectives

Business challenge • Growth

• Setup complexity

• Budget for DR

• Service availability in disaster

Our solution provides• Automated storage

tiering and self-tuning• Ease of provisioning

and management• Heterogeneous

replication and bandwidth saving

• Automatic site failover with good RTO/RPO

Page 5: EMC Infrastructure for Microsoft Applications in the Private Cloud

5© Copyright 2012 EMC Corporation. All rights reserved.

Solution Architecture

Page 6: EMC Infrastructure for Microsoft Applications in the Private Cloud

6© Copyright 2012 EMC Corporation. All rights reserved.

Hyper-V Cluster and Virtual Machines Distribute virtual machines in the same application

role into different Hyper-V nodes for redundancy 200 GB boot LUNs for each virtual machine All DB and log LUNs as pass-through disks

Page 7: EMC Infrastructure for Microsoft Applications in the Private Cloud

7© Copyright 2012 EMC Corporation. All rights reserved.

Hardware resourcesEquipment Quantity Configuration

EMC® Symmetrix® VMAX 10K® 1

2 system bays and 1 storage bayEnginuity version: 5875.230.172.e

• 200 GB Flash drives: 17• 450 GB 15k rpm FC drives: 100• 600 GB 10k rpm FC drives: 82• 2 TB 7.2k rpm SATA drives: 89

EMC VNX®5700 1Block OE code: 5.31.000.5.704

• 600 GB 10k rpm SAS drives: 56• 2 TB 7.2k rpm NL-SAS drives: 160

RecoverPoint 4 4 RecoverPoint appliances (two per site)

FC switch 2 8 Gb FC Switch (one per site)GbE network switch 2 48-port IP Switch

Servers 11

8 x Hyper-V servers (4 x 4 processors CPU and 128 GB RAM)1 x management server (4 x 4 processors CPU and 32 GB RAM)2 x Domain Controller servers (4 processors and 4 GB RAM)

Page 8: EMC Infrastructure for Microsoft Applications in the Private Cloud

8© Copyright 2012 EMC Corporation. All rights reserved.

Software resourcesSoftware Configuration

Microsoft Components

Hyper-V cluster nodes Windows Server 2008 R2 with SP1

Virtual machine operating system Windows Server 2008 R2 with SP1

SQL Server 2012 RTM Enterprise Edition

Exchange Server 2010 Enterprise Edition with SP2

SharePoint Server 2010 Enterprise Edition with SP1

System Center Virtual Machine Manager (SCVMM) 2008 R2 SP1

System Center Operations Manager (SCOM) 2007 R2

EMC Components

PowerPath Version 5.5 SP1

RecoverPoint Version 3.4.3

EMC Storage Integrator (ESI) Version 1.3 

EMC Cluster Enabler Version 4.1.2

Page 9: EMC Infrastructure for Microsoft Applications in the Private Cloud

9© Copyright 2012 EMC Corporation. All rights reserved.

Each application has its own policy, but shares the same tiers

FAST VP Configuration

Tier No. of disks RAID

Flash – 200 GB 12 RAID 5 (3+1)FC – 450 GB 15k rpm 80 RAID 5 (3+1)SATA – 2 TB 7.2k rpm 68 RAID 1

Application Tiers Policy

Exchange FC and SATA 10:90SharePoint Flash, FC, and SATA 10:80:10SQL Flash, FC, and SATA 25:65:10

Page 10: EMC Infrastructure for Microsoft Applications in the Private Cloud

10© Copyright 2012 EMC Corporation. All rights reserved.

Application Design and Test Results FAST VP baseline testing without

RecoverPoint replication in place RecoverPoint CRR protection impact

on applications:– 25 ms network latency (round trip)– 85 ms network latency (round trip)

Page 11: EMC Infrastructure for Microsoft Applications in the Private Cloud

11© Copyright 2012 EMC Corporation. All rights reserved.

Exchange Server 2010 User ProfileItem ValueNumber of Exchange 2010 users 10,000Number of Mailbox Server virtual machines 4

Number of DAGs and database copies 1 DAG with 2 copies

Number of users per Mailbox Server5,000 total mailboxes(2,500 active and 2,500 passive during normal operating conditions)

User profile (in DAG configuration) 100 messages/user/day (0.10 IOPS)Read:Write ratio 3:2 in a DAG configurationMailbox size Start at 500 MB, grow to 2 GBTarget average message size 75 KBDeleted items retention window 14 daysLogs protection buffer 3 days24 x 7 BDM configuration Enabled

Page 12: EMC Infrastructure for Microsoft Applications in the Private Cloud

12© Copyright 2012 EMC Corporation. All rights reserved.

Exchange Server 2010 Design Exchange DAG configuration

Role No. of VMs vCPU RAM

(GB) Description Pass-through disks (GB)

No. of pass-through disks per

VMHUB/ CAS 4 4 16 N/A N/A N/A

MBX 4 4 8Database LUNs 1.8 TB 10

Log LUNs 100 GB 10

Exchange virtual machine design

Page 13: EMC Infrastructure for Microsoft Applications in the Private Cloud

13© Copyright 2012 EMC Corporation. All rights reserved.

Exchange Sever 2010 Performance ResultFAST VP baseline

– ~60% CPU usage on MBX servers

– Healthy disk latency

FAST VP with RecoverPoint– RecoverPoint CRR replication has little

impact on Exchange Server 2010 performance

Page 14: EMC Infrastructure for Microsoft Applications in the Private Cloud

14© Copyright 2012 EMC Corporation. All rights reserved.

SQL Server 2012 User ProfileItem Value

SQL database capacity and user profile

3 user databases per SQL Server: 1 x 50 GB (5,000 user) 1 x 100 GB (10,000 user) 1 x 150 GB (15,000 user)

Number of SQL Server instances 2 Number of user databases for each virtual machine 3

Number of virtual machines 2

Total database size 600 GB

Number of total users 60,000

Read/Write ratio 85:15 online transaction processing (OLTP)

Concurrent users Mixed (to simulate hot, warm and cold workloads across the databases)

Page 15: EMC Infrastructure for Microsoft Applications in the Private Cloud

15© Copyright 2012 EMC Corporation. All rights reserved.

SQL Server 2012 Design

Role No. of VMs vCPU RAM

(GB)Pass-

through disks (GB)

DescriptionNo. of pass-

through disks

SQL Server 2 4 16

250 Database LUN of 150 GB DB 1

125 Log LUN of 150 GB DB 1

200 Database LUN of 100 GB DB 1

100 Log LUN of 100 GB DB 1

150 Database LUN of 50 GB DB 1

75 Log LUN of 50 GB DB 1

100 SQL tempdb data 4

50 SQL tempdb log 1

Page 16: EMC Infrastructure for Microsoft Applications in the Private Cloud

16© Copyright 2012 EMC Corporation. All rights reserved.

SQL Sever 2012 Performance ResultFAST VP baseline

– ~9,000 IOPS and ~80% CPU on two SQL Servers

– Healthy disk latency

FAST VP with RecoverPoint– RecoverPoint CRR replication has little

impact on SQL Server 2012 performance

Page 17: EMC Infrastructure for Microsoft Applications in the Private Cloud

17© Copyright 2012 EMC Corporation. All rights reserved.

SharePoint Server 2010 User ProfileItem Value

Total user count 10,000

Usage profile (%browse/%search/%modify) 80%/10%/10%

User concurrency 10%

Total data 4 TB

Content database size 1 TB

Total site collections count 20

Sites per site collection 10

Document size range 10 KB–10 MB

Page 18: EMC Infrastructure for Microsoft Applications in the Private Cloud

18© Copyright 2012 EMC Corporation. All rights reserved.

SharePoint Server 2010 Design

Role No. of VMs vCPU RAM

(GB)Pass-through disks (GB) Description No. of pass-through

disks per VM

WFE 3 4 4 120 Query Component 2

Index 2 4 8 80 Index Component 2

SQL Server

1 4 32

1200 Content DB data 230 Content DB log 250 Config/Admin DB 180 + 20 Property DB 80 GB and 20 GB220 + 50 Crawl DB 220 GB and 50 GB50 Temp DB 5

1 4 321200 Content DB data 230 Content DB log 250 Temp DB 5

Page 19: EMC Infrastructure for Microsoft Applications in the Private Cloud

19© Copyright 2012 EMC Corporation. All rights reserved.

SharePoint Sever 2010 Performance ResultFAST VP baseline

– 58 Passed Tests/sec– 35,308 heavy users at 10%

concurrency– Healthy response time

FAST VP with RecoverPoint– RecoverPoint CRR replication has little

impact on SharePoint Server 2010 performance

Page 20: EMC Infrastructure for Microsoft Applications in the Private Cloud

20© Copyright 2012 EMC Corporation. All rights reserved.

VMAX 10K Performance Result Array utilization:

– BE UT: ~50%– FE UT: ~25%

– Disk UT: ▪ FC & SATA: ~60%▪ Flash: ~30%

Benefits• Automatic storage

tiering to the changing application needs

• Application protection without performance downgrade

• Additional room for future growth

Page 21: EMC Infrastructure for Microsoft Applications in the Private Cloud

21© Copyright 2012 EMC Corporation. All rights reserved.

System Management

Page 22: EMC Infrastructure for Microsoft Applications in the Private Cloud

22© Copyright 2012 EMC Corporation. All rights reserved.

System Management

SCVMM for VM deployment

ESI for storage provisioning

SCOM for monitoring

Page 23: EMC Infrastructure for Microsoft Applications in the Private Cloud

23© Copyright 2012 EMC Corporation. All rights reserved.

DR Design and Test Results RecoverPoint compression ratio and

RPO results RecoverPoint/CE failover:

– Planned failover (Live Migration)– Unplanned failover (site disaster

recovery)

Page 24: EMC Infrastructure for Microsoft Applications in the Private Cloud

24© Copyright 2012 EMC Corporation. All rights reserved.

RecoverPoint Journal Sizing Journal volume sizing formula

Journal sizing for this solutionProduction site DR site

Protection window 1 day 3 days

Journal size

Exchange Mailbox 75 GB Exchange Mailbox 250 GB

Exchange HUB/CAS 5 GB Exchange HUB/CAS 20 GB

SQL Server 75 GB SQL Server 250 GB

SharePoint SQL Server 100 GB SharePoint SQL Server 300 GB

SharePoint Application 5 GB SharePoint Application 20 GB

SharePoint WFE 15 GB SharePoint WFE 50 GB

Page 25: EMC Infrastructure for Microsoft Applications in the Private Cloud

25© Copyright 2012 EMC Corporation. All rights reserved.

RecoverPoint/Cluster Enabler Setup1. Setup Hyper-V Cluster on Production site2. Configure one consistency group per virtual

machine and match names3. Finish consistency group initial replication4. Set the correct consistency group policy5. Use Cluster Enabler to configure the cluster

and add nodes from the DR site6. Test failover using Live Migration

2

4

Page 26: EMC Infrastructure for Microsoft Applications in the Private Cloud

26© Copyright 2012 EMC Corporation. All rights reserved.

RecoverPoint Compression Ratio 3x compression ratio on Exchange Mailbox

Server and SQL Server virtual machines

1.5x compression ratio on the SharePoint SQL virtual machines

Page 27: EMC Infrastructure for Microsoft Applications in the Private Cloud

27© Copyright 2012 EMC Corporation. All rights reserved.

RecoverPoint RPO in 85 ms latency Data lag:

– 40 MB for MBX– 20 MB for SQL– 10 MB for others

Time lag: <3 sec

Benefits

• Network bandwidth saving

• Good RPO

Page 28: EMC Infrastructure for Microsoft Applications in the Private Cloud

28© Copyright 2012 EMC Corporation. All rights reserved.

Planned Failover Failover time  25 ms latency 85 ms latency

Virtual machineClient

unavailability time

Cluster migration

time

Client unavailability

time

Cluster migration

time

SharePointSQL 105 sec 105 sec 105 sec 111 secWFE 90 sec 96 sec 80 sec 92 secAPP 0 sec 86 sec 0 sec 95 sec

SQL Server 99 sec 120 sec 105 sec 120 sec

SharePointresumed servingclients afterfailing over

Page 29: EMC Infrastructure for Microsoft Applications in the Private Cloud

29© Copyright 2012 EMC Corporation. All rights reserved.

Unplanned Failover Site failover time

SharePoint farm behavior

Event 25 ms 85 ms

Virtual machine online 5 min 40 sec 4 min 57 secExchange responding to clients 16 min 39 sec 16 min 18sec

SQL Server responding to clients 13 min 35 sec 18 min 7 sec

SharePoint responding to clients

14 min 5 sec 15 min 50 sec

Benefits• A comprehensive

data protection solution for the entire data center

• Zero user intervention during site failover

Page 30: EMC Infrastructure for Microsoft Applications in the Private Cloud

30© Copyright 2012 EMC Corporation. All rights reserved.

Summary

Page 31: EMC Infrastructure for Microsoft Applications in the Private Cloud

31© Copyright 2012 EMC Corporation. All rights reserved.

Key Findings Desired performance to meet the needs of the

following application configurations:– SharePoint: 35,308 heavy users at 10 percent concurrency– SQL: 60,000 users with more than 4,000 SQL transactions

processed and 9,000 IOPS – Exchange: 10,000 concurrent users at 0.10 IOPS profile

Ease of provisioning and simplified management of the whole infrastructure

A comprehensive data protection solution with 100% automatic site failover and good RTO and RPO

– 3x compression ratio for most data– 3 second time lag and 18 minute freezing time to client

(worst case) during site failover in 85ms network latency

Page 32: EMC Infrastructure for Microsoft Applications in the Private Cloud

32© Copyright 2012 EMC Corporation. All rights reserved.

Reference Whitepaper: http://www.emc.com/collateral/hardware/white-papers/h10720-emc-inf

str-msapps-private-cloud-wp.pdf

Demos: http://www.youtube.com/playlist?list=PLE77DA2CD44C6F27F&feature

=plcp– Hyper-V pass-through disks provisioning by ESI– Live Migration of a SharePoint SQL Server– Automatic site failover and SharePoint behaviors– Automatic site failover and Exchange behaviors

Page 33: EMC Infrastructure for Microsoft Applications in the Private Cloud